The `co2signal` sensor platform queries the [CO2Signal](https://www.co2signal.com/) API for the CO2 intensity of a specific region. Data can be collected for your home, a specific latitude/longitude or by country code. This API uses the same data as <https://www.electricitymap.org>. Not all countries/regions in the world are supported so please consult this website to check local availability.
## Prerequisites
To configure and use this integration, you need to obtain a [free API key from CO2Signal](https://www.co2signal.com/).

## Sensor Types
When configured, the platform will create two sensors for each configured location: the carbon intensity expressed in `gCO2eq/kWh` and a percentage how much the grid relies on fossil fuels for production.
